What motivated you to join the Wharton Global C-Suite Program?

The bank where I worked was acquired under distressed circumstances, triggering a series of senior management changes. The people I was reporting to changed numerous times within a 12-month period, and I had to continually introduce myself and revalidate my team and our work. I sought to transition into a more strategic role, strengthening my position within both the organization and the industry to navigate complex situations more effectively.

What is one framework, insight, or way of thinking from the program that you have already applied in your role?

The biggest insight that I took away from the Wharton Global C-Suite Program was “thinking like a CEO.” When I applied this way of thinking to my role, I gained a lot of perspective on how different scenarios could play out and the various viewpoints that I should consider during my strategy and decision-making.

Can you share an example of something you applied at work from the Wharton Global C-Suite Program?

Given the changing reporting structure that was happening around me in real-time while I was taking this Wharton executive leadership development program​, I was able to better understand what a “new set of eyes” would look for when evaluating my department and team. After spending 12 years with my organization, I focused on breaking away from the approach my former C-Suite team would have taken and tried to adopt a fresh perspective, utilizing the fundamentals I had learned from the course. Having gained valuable insights from the case studies and lessons provided by our instructors, I was able to effectively apply them to my specific role.
